    THE PRE-MAPPING SENTENCE PLANNER IN MULTILINGUAL NATURAL LANGUAGE GENERATION SYSTEM

    • Natural language generation is the research area that studies how the computer can be used to generate natural language text. Its classic architecture is a pipeline structure consisting of three parts: macroplanner, microplanner and surface generator. Analyzed in this paper is the microplanner in the ACNLG, a multilingual nature language generation system, and the concept “sentence optimizer based on language resource pre mapping” is put forward. It does not only optimize the sentences, but also maps the language independent content into each language’s resource, and the processing should follow the instruction of the language resource. This sentence optimizer has all the ability of the classic method, and solves the problem that in the multilingual environment it is hard to handle the nuance of each language. It can optimize the sentences according to the feature of the target language, and increase the ability of the sentence optimizer greatly.
